Therapist in Sugar Land, TX

Therapists (also called counselors or psychotherapists) hold a master's degree and state licensure (LPC, LCSW, or LMFT). They deliver evidence-based talk therapies including CBT, DBT, EMDR, and psychodynamic therapy. Unlike psychiatrists, therapists do not prescribe medication — their work is entirely therapy-based, often in weekly or biweekly sessions.
